ANOBAG vs Payroll company

Hi all, I have the chance of a new job, but the business is not domiciled in Switzerland and will just pay a flat rate to either me or a company invoicing them (they don't care which), meaning I broadly have 2 options:

-Use a payroll company (such as Payroll plus) to invoice the business who then pays me, taking all necessary contributions

-The business pays me directly and then I register as ANOBAG and pay the social contributions directly

(Yes I know there are other options like creating a GMBH etc, but that's out of scope for now)

As I see it, the payroll company would be the least hassle, but as I'm already a long-term resident, can speak enough German to get by, I don't mind a bit of extra admin work if it will be financially beneficial to go ANOBAG

Below I put a calculation based on a payroll company (excl pension), based on 10k/month deductions would be around 1700chf / 17%.

ANOBAG I think would be: AHV (10.6%), ALV (2.2%), FAK (2%) = 14.8%

I'm slightly confused on the FAK / Family Allowance as not sure whether everyone pays that, or it's related to if you have kids.

It seems at the ANOBAG route would be exactly the same financially as payroll, but then an extra 2% for the middleman commission for the payroll company option.

Any views on the above, experiences, or recommendations on which route to take? thanks

The UVG (accident) is mandatory, KTG (sickness) is not. But the firm maybe want it.

UVG: you are usually insured up to ~148K. Above this level you need to be insured with an additional insurance (UVG-Z). The price is not shared 50/50.

KTG: you have the choice of the waiting period. This is influencing the price you pay. KTG is usually paid by the employee.
